Remember those taco-in-a-box kits? You know, the ones with spice packets and U-shaped crunchy tortillas? These aren't those. Consider these "North of the Border" Tacos a grown-up (and way better) version. Get the recipe: www.rickbayless...

I cooked the ground beef as recommended, then added a can of diced tomatoes/green chiles, and added a can of thoroughly rinsed black beans for the filling of a Mexican casserole, and it was freaking amazing. My wife took a bite and got that look you get when you want everyone to know how good something is. She said she had never eaten a casserole with that much flavor. Disclaimer: I used one T of Chipotle powder and one T of regular chili powder in place of the two T ancho powder because I didn't have powdered ancho. I ate thirds on this it was so addictive!
